Job Description:  Overview:

Our Environmental Services group is dedicated to managing environmental issues professionally and proactively. We provide integrated, multidisciplinary services to identify and assess liabilities and risks, and to develop solutions to site management, remediation, and mitigation. Our staff of professionals includes specialists in marine biology, wetland science, wildlife biology, soil science, fisheries biology, botany, hydrogeology, hydrology, water resources management, forestry, habitat and ecosystem restoration, permitting, GIS, information management, environmental monitoring, in-situ/ex-situ remedial design and implementation, human health and ecological risk assessments, air quality permitting and reporting, pipeline compliance, stormwater permitting and planning, and audit support services . We are seeking exceptionally talented and enthusiastic individuals with a keen interest in the natural sciences to join our team and advance their career.

Responsibilities:

Stantec is seeking a Regulatory Compliance Specialist to address Federal, State and local permit applications and reporting requirements associated with various environmental statues and regulations. This individual will need to know and be able to quickly address relevant regulatory and technical requirements.

Qualifications:
  • A Bachelor or Masters degree in Environmental Science, Environmental Health and Safety, Geology, or Environmental Engineering with a focus on environmental regulatory compliance
  • 0-5 years of experience
  • Familiarity with CERCLA, RCRA, NPDES/SPDES, CWA, SDWA, PBS and CBS regulations required
  • Experience as a liaison between clients and permitting agencies is a plus
  • Public presentation experience is a plus
  • 40 hour OSHA training is a plus
  • GIS experience is a plus
  • Excellent oral and written communication skills
  • Position requires strict adherence to health and safety procedures, attention to detail, outstanding work ethic, and a passion for high quality workmanship
  • Proficient with Microsoft Excel, Word, and PowerPoint
